Python program with full screen counter and GPIO button interface
3396 UAHI need a simplified script written in Python to manage a queue of people with the following features:
- read initial settings (variables) such as client number and department from a local file
- connect to a remote database to fetch the current "turn" number and increase it on the table (MySQL) based on the values previously read from the file
- Initialize full screen and display the current "turn" number in black big font on white background
- Allow for a button to be pressed (by reading the GPIO value from either a Raspberry Pi or an Orange Pi) and advance the number by writing the new number on the MySQL table and updating the screen. Additionally by pressing this button a new entry on a different table should be produced. This will show which button was pressed and when.
- Allow for a different button to be pressed. This second button will save the current number and will fetch it 3 times in the future with red letters in between the regular ascending "turn" numbers. After the third time, this number should not be seen anymore.
- Finally, allow for the existence of several other buttons such as the first (which will also advance the turn but will be registered as a different button on the table that records button presses. The objective of these entries is for analytics.
I have written this program already and it works (excluding the red text), I just started coding in Python so I believe my code suffers from a lot of illnesses, therefore, I am willing to pay to have this rewritten.
I can supply additional details such as the structure of the tables, local file with settings, etc.
Приложения 1
Актуальные фриланс-проекты в категории Python
Разработка программного обеспечения с ИИНеобходимо разработать программное обеспечение для автоматического обнаружения, захвата и сопровождения объекта с помощью видеокамеры и поворотного механизма.Исходные данные: Видеокамера с оптикой. Поворотное устройство по двум осям (азимут/угол места). Сервоприводы с… AI и машинное обучение, Python ∙ 15 минут назад ∙ 3 ставки |
ТЗ НА ДОПРАЦЮВАНИЕ AI-БОТА ГЕНЕРАЦИИ ЛИЧНЫХ ПЕСЕНТЗ НА ДОПРАЦЮВАННЯ AI-БОТА ГЕНЕРАЦІЇ ПЕРСОНАЛЬНИХ ПІСЕНЬГОЛОВНА ЦІЛЬ Створити стабільний преміальний продукт, який: генерує максимально якісні персональні пісні; не вигадує факти про клієнта; працює стабільно під навантаженням; легко масштабується; дозволяє аналізувати та… Python, Разработка ботов ∙ 1 час 20 минут назад ∙ 12 ставок |
Специалист по Excel / автоматизации процессов (Excel + желательно программирование)Ищем специалиста с ПРОДВИНУТЫМИ знаниями Excel для оптимизации существующего файла и автоматизации процессов. Будет большим преимуществом, если вы также имеете навыки программирования / VBA / Power Query / Power Automate или опыт создания сложной логики в Excel. Задачи проекта… Python, Базы данных и SQL ∙ 4 часа 19 минут назад ∙ 22 ставки |
Автоматизация процессоів через API и PhytonНиже описал текущий процесс и то, к какому результату хотелось бы прийти. Также прикладіваю файлы реалтного процесса чтобы лучше понять как он выглядит в ревльности Текущий процесс Сейчас весь процесс выполняется вручную: загрузка/выгрузка файлов, перенос данных между… AI и машинное обучение, Python ∙ 5 часов 20 минут назад ∙ 29 ставок |
Необходимо создать бота в ТГ для оплаты подписки.
2000 UAH
Необходимо создать бота в телеграме, где пользователь сможет оформить подписку на доступ к веб-камерам, которые находятся во дворе. Организовать в боте оплату двух видов подписок (на месяц и на один день). Бот должен автоматически проверять оплату и после выдавать ссылку-доступа. Python, Разработка ботов ∙ 18 часов 6 минут назад ∙ 71 ставка |